Abstract

Multivariate statistical analyses of the morphometric characters of worker bees of Apis cer- ana were collected from 188 colonies at 68 localities throughout China with a sampling resolution of 1 locality/50 000 km 2 . Principal components plots revealed one morphocluster. By introducing local labeling it become clear that bees from different localities form overlapping regional clusters: 1. bees from Jinlin, Liaoning, Beijing and northern Shanxi provinces; 2. larger bees from southern Ganshu and northern and central Sichuan; 3. smaller bees from southern Yunnan, Guangdon, Guangxi, Hong Kong and Hainan; 4. bees from the rest of China. Hierarchical cluster analysis using data for the China regional groups 1 to 4 and adjacent countries yielded a dendrogram of two main clusters. Colonies from Japan, Korea and Russia were linked with those from China regional groups 1, 2 and 4; colonies from northern Vietnam, north eastern India, Thailand and Myanmar were linked with those from China regional group 3. A. cerana populations are continuous and panmictic, and morphometric structuring is indistinct.
